Formaldehyde: More Than Just Preservative Commonly used to preserve dead bodies, formaldehyde in cigarette smoke is a brutal respiratory irritant and a known cause of leukaemia and cancers in nasal and respiratory tissues

Most of the women involved in the bidi industry work from home, often assisted by their children, and, according to a research paper, are themselves prone to health problems, such as musculoskeletal, respiratory, eye, and skin problems

Smoking Smoking means inhaling, exhaling, burning, or carrying any lighted or heated cigar, cigarette, cigarillo, pipe, hookah, or any other lighted or heated tobacco, plant or chemical product intended for inhalation, whether natural or synthetic, in any manner or in any form
